Tic Tac Toe is a simple yet timeless game that has been enjoyed by people of all ages for generations. Also known as Noughts and Crosses, this classic game involves two players taking turns marking squares in a 3×3 grid with either X or O.

The player who succeeds in placing three of their marks in a horizontal, vertical, or diagonal row wins the game. 

Despite its simplicity, Tic Tac Toe remains a popular game that has been played all around the world and has even inspired more complex variations and strategies. Rules to play tic tac toe games?

Tic Tac Toe is typically played on a 3×3 grid, although variations with different grid sizes also exist. Two players take turns marking empty squares on the grid with their chosen symbol, usually X and O.

The first player to get three of their symbols in a row (horizontally, vertically, or diagonally) wins the game. If all squares on the grid are filled and no player has three in a row, the game ends in a tie.

Players must take turns and cannot occupy a square that has already been played. Once a player has placed a symbol in a square, they cannot move or remove it. The game can be played as a best-of series, with the winner of each game receiving one point or as a single-game match.

Tic tac toe strategy

Tic Tac Toe is a simple game, but it does require some strategy if you want to win consistently. Here are some tips to help you develop a winning strategy:

Control the center: The center square is the most strategically important in Tic Tac Toe. If you can claim it, you have a better chance of winning the game.

Watch for patterns: Look for potential winning patterns, such as three in a row, and try to block your opponent from forming them. At the same time, try to set up your potential winning patterns.

Plan: Don’t just focus on the current move, but also think ahead to your next few moves. Try to set up multiple potential winning patterns at the same time.

Play offensively: While it’s important to block your opponent’s moves, don’t forget to play offensively as well. Look for opportunities to make your winning moves.

Be unpredictable: Try to randomize your moves as much as possible to keep your opponent guessing. If you’re too predictable, your opponent can easily block your moves and prevent you from winning.

Don’t forget the corners: While the center square is the most strategically important, the corners are also important. If you can claim a corner, you can potentially set up multiple winning patterns at the same time.

Remember, Tic Tac Toe is a game of strategy, so don’t just make moves randomly. Think ahead, look for patterns, and play both defensively and offensively to increase your chances of winning.
